3-Bromo-6-methoxy-2-methyl-5-nitropyridine

Description:
3-Bromo-6-methoxy-2-methyl-5-nitropyridine is a heterocyclic organic compound characterized by its pyridine ring, which is a six-membered aromatic ring containing one nitrogen atom. This compound features several functional groups, including a bromine atom at the 3-position, a methoxy group (-OCH3) at the 6-position, a methyl group (-CH3) at the 2-position, and a nitro group (-NO2) at the 5-position. These substituents contribute to its chemical reactivity and physical properties. The presence of the nitro group typically enhances the compound's electrophilic character, making it useful in various chemical reactions, including nucleophilic substitutions. The methoxy group can influence the compound's solubility and polarity, while the bromine atom can serve as a site for further chemical modifications. Overall, this compound is of interest in synthetic organic chemistry and may have applications in pharmaceuticals or agrochemicals due to its unique structural features.
Formula:C7H7BrN2O3
InChI:InChI=1S/C7H7BrN2O3/c1-4-5(8)3-6(10(11)12)7(9-4)13-2/h3H,1-2H3
InChI key:InChIKey=VQVXYSCNTSWXJC-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ILES:N(=O)(=O)C1=C(OC)N=C(C)C(Br)=C1
Synonyms:
  • 3-Bromo-6-methoxy-2-methyl-5-nitropyridine
  • Pyridine, 3-bromo-6-methoxy-2-methyl-5-nitro-
